Employed workers with social security, aged 15-64, rural in Ecuador
Ecuador: Employed workers with social security, aged 15-64, rural was 0.4% in 2017. ◆ Volatile
Employed workers with social security, aged 15-64, rural in Ecuador, 1994–2017
Source: World Bank. Measured in % of rural employed population in working age.
Analysis
Ecuador recorded 0.4% for employed workers with social security, aged 15-64, rural in 2017.
The figure is down 13.6% on the previous year and up 425.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, employed workers with social security, aged 15-64, rural in Ecuador peaked at 0.4% in 2016 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 1994.
That places Ecuador 10th out of 27 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
